Step into a pivotal role at Edmonton Police as a Strategic Planning Analyst II, where you will connect strategic objectives to operational practices. Provide crucial analytical and advisory support to enhance promotion processes and ensure alignment with EPS goals.
This full-time temporary position will extend until December 31, 2026. The analyst will play a key role within the Recruiting & Promotion Branch, focusing on strategic analysis, evaluation frameworks, and continuous improvement for effective decision-making. Your ability to translate organizational priorities into actionable strategies will drive transformation at EPS.
Key Responsibilities:
• Provide strategic analysis and evaluation advice to leadership
• Design and maintain evaluation frameworks for promotion processes
• Conduct research to identify best practices in public sector promotions
• Analyze data and trends for operational decision-making
• Prepare evidence-based reports and business cases for stakeholders
Requirements:
• Minimum of five years in strategic planning or related fields
• University degree in Business, Public Administration, or a related area
• Proficient in project management and business analytics
• Robust analytical skills with experience using quantitative methods
• Excellent communication skills for collaboration and stakeholder engagement
